Take-Two Sues GTA Modders Trying To Dodge DMCA

October 5, 2021

By Aron Gerencser

These past few months, Take-Two Interactive has been going around hunting down Grand Theft Auto modders.

With the imminent release of Grand Theft Auto: The Trilogy - The Definitive Edition, it is clear that the company was nuking the competition.

When one group fought back, they got hit by a lawsuit.

Take-Two was specifically targeting mods that amounted to fan-made remasters of GTA games.

Most of the mods and modding teams that were issued DMCAs went quietly.

The modders behind Re3 and reVC ran two projects that reverse-engineered the code and assets of GTA 3 and Vice City.

GitHub initially took down the files after Take-Two issued the DMCA, which then the modders counter-claimed.

Take-Two's legal team has gone and launched an infringement lawsuit in California.
